A heated argument between football fans turned deadly in Kyobugombe Trading Centre, Western Uganda, on Sunday, October 27th.
Cyber Reporters gathered that Benjamin Okello, 22, a Manchester United supporter, lost his life after a dispute with an Arsenal fan, identified as Onan.
The clash erupted over celebrations and taunts following Arsenal’s 2-2 draw with Liverpool.
Okello threw popcorn at Onan, escalating the situation. After the match, the two engaged in a scuffle, resulting in Okello being hit with a stick.
According to Kaharo Sub County Chairperson, the confrontation began in a local video hall where fans gathered to watch the match. “When Liverpool scored an equalizer, Okello started jubilating, angering Onan,” he said.
District Police Commander Joseph Bakaleke confirmed the incident, stating that police received reports of a scuffle between two fans, resulting in one being assaulted and later succumbing to injuries.
Onan, reportedly known for criminal activity in the area, is now the subject of an active police manhunt. Authorities have urged anyone with information to come forward.
Relatives of Okello demand justice, while police appeal for calm.
“We encourage the relatives to remain calm as we search for the suspect and gather information,” said Bakaleke.
